24 | /* | |
25 | Driver: amplc_pci230 | |
26 | Description: Amplicon PCI230, PCI260 Multifunction I/O boards | |
27 | Author: Allan Willcox <allanwillcox@ozemail.com.au>, | |
28 | Steve D Sharples <steve.sharples@nottingham.ac.uk>, | |
29 | Ian Abbott <abbotti@mev.co.uk> | |
30 | Updated: Wed, 22 Oct 2008 12:34:49 +0100 | |
31 | Devices: [Amplicon] PCI230 (pci230 or amplc_pci230), | |
32 | PCI230+ (pci230+ or amplc_pci230), | |
33 | PCI260 (pci260 or amplc_pci230), PCI260+ (pci260+ or amplc_pci230) | |
34 | Status: works | |
35 | ||
36 | Configuration options: | |
37 | [0] - PCI bus of device (optional). | |
38 | [1] - PCI slot of device (optional). | |
39 | If bus/slot is not specified, the first available PCI device | |
40 | will be used. | |
41 | ||
42 | Configuring a "amplc_pci230" will match any supported card and it will | |
43 | choose the best match, picking the "+" models if possible. Configuring | |
44 | a "pci230" will match a PCI230 or PCI230+ card and it will be treated as | |
45 | a PCI230. Configuring a "pci260" will match a PCI260 or PCI260+ card | |
46 | and it will be treated as a PCI260. Configuring a "pci230+" will match | |
47 | a PCI230+ card. Configuring a "pci260+" will match a PCI260+ card. | |
48 | ||
49 | Subdevices: | |
50 | ||
51 | PCI230(+) PCI260(+) | |
52 | --------- --------- | |
53 | Subdevices 3 1 | |
54 | 0 AI AI | |
55 | 1 AO | |
56 | 2 DIO | |
57 | ||
58 | AI Subdevice: | |
59 | ||
60 | The AI subdevice has 16 single-ended channels or 8 differential | |
61 | channels. | |
62 | ||
63 | The PCI230 and PCI260 cards have 12-bit resolution. The PCI230+ and | |
64 | PCI260+ cards have 16-bit resolution. | |
65 | ||
66 | For differential mode, use inputs 2N and 2N+1 for channel N (e.g. use | |
67 | inputs 14 and 15 for channel 7). If the card is physically a PCI230 | |
68 | or PCI260 then it actually uses a "pseudo-differential" mode where the | |
69 | inputs are sampled a few microseconds apart. The PCI230+ and PCI260+ | |
70 | use true differential sampling. Another difference is that if the | |
71 | card is physically a PCI230 or PCI260, the inverting input is 2N, | |
72 | whereas for a PCI230+ or PCI260+ the inverting input is 2N+1. So if a | |
73 | PCI230 is physically replaced by a PCI230+ (or a PCI260 with a | |
74 | PCI260+) and differential mode is used, the differential inputs need | |
75 | to be physically swapped on the connector. | |

77 | The following input ranges are supported: | |
78 | ||
79 | 0 => [-10, +10] V | |
80 | 1 => [-5, +5] V | |
81 | 2 => [-2.5, +2.5] V | |
82 | 3 => [-1.25, +1.25] V | |
83 | 4 => [0, 10] V | |
84 | 5 => [0, 5] V | |
85 | 6 => [0, 2.5] V | |
86 | ||
87 | AI Commands: | |
88 | ||
89 | +=========+==============+===========+============+==========+ | |
90 | |start_src|scan_begin_src|convert_src|scan_end_src| stop_src | | |
91 | +=========+==============+===========+============+==========+ | |
92 | |TRIG_NOW | TRIG_FOLLOW |TRIG_TIMER | TRIG_COUNT |TRIG_NONE | | |
93 | |TRIG_INT | |TRIG_EXT(3)| |TRIG_COUNT| | |
94 | | | |TRIG_INT | | | | |
95 | | |--------------|-----------| | | | |
96 | | | TRIG_TIMER(1)|TRIG_TIMER | | | | |
97 | | | TRIG_EXT(2) | | | | | |
98 | | | TRIG_INT | | | | | |
99 | +---------+--------------+-----------+------------+----------+ | |
100 | ||
101 | Note 1: If AI command and AO command are used simultaneously, only | |
102 | one may have scan_begin_src == TRIG_TIMER. | |
103 | ||
104 | Note 2: For PCI230 and PCI230+, scan_begin_src == TRIG_EXT uses | |
105 | DIO channel 16 (pin 49) which will need to be configured as | |
106 | a digital input. For PCI260+, the EXTTRIG/EXTCONVCLK input | |
107 | (pin 17) is used instead. For PCI230, scan_begin_src == | |
108 | TRIG_EXT is not supported. The trigger is a rising edge | |
109 | on the input. | |
110 | ||
111 | Note 3: For convert_src == TRIG_EXT, the EXTTRIG/EXTCONVCLK input | |
112 | (pin 25 on PCI230(+), pin 17 on PCI260(+)) is used. The | |
113 | convert_arg value is interpreted as follows: | |
114 | ||
115 | convert_arg == (CR_EDGE | 0) => rising edge | |
116 | convert_arg == (CR_EDGE | CR_INVERT | 0) => falling edge | |
117 | convert_arg == 0 => falling edge (backwards compatibility) | |
118 | convert_arg == 1 => rising edge (backwards compatibility) | |
119 | ||
120 | All entries in the channel list must use the same analogue reference. | |
121 | If the analogue reference is not AREF_DIFF (not differential) each | |
122 | pair of channel numbers (0 and 1, 2 and 3, etc.) must use the same | |
123 | input range. The input ranges used in the sequence must be all | |
124 | bipolar (ranges 0 to 3) or all unipolar (ranges 4 to 6). The channel | |
125 | sequence must consist of 1 or more identical subsequences. Within the | |
126 | subsequence, channels must be in ascending order with no repeated | |
127 | channels. For example, the following sequences are valid: 0 1 2 3 | |
128 | (single valid subsequence), 0 2 3 5 0 2 3 5 (repeated valid | |
129 | subsequence), 1 1 1 1 (repeated valid subsequence). The following | |
130 | sequences are invalid: 0 3 2 1 (invalid subsequence), 0 2 3 5 0 2 3 | |
131 | (incompletely repeated subsequence). Some versions of the PCI230+ and | |
132 | PCI260+ have a bug that requires a subsequence longer than one entry | |
133 | long to include channel 0. | |

135 | AO Subdevice: | |
136 | ||
137 | The AO subdevice has 2 channels with 12-bit resolution. | |
138 | ||
139 | The following output ranges are supported: | |
140 | ||
141 | 0 => [0, 10] V | |
142 | 1 => [-10, +10] V | |
143 | ||
144 | AO Commands: | |
145 | ||
146 | +=========+==============+===========+============+==========+ | |
147 | |start_src|scan_begin_src|convert_src|scan_end_src| stop_src | | |
148 | +=========+==============+===========+============+==========+ | |
149 | |TRIG_INT | TRIG_TIMER(1)| TRIG_NOW | TRIG_COUNT |TRIG_NONE | | |
150 | | | TRIG_EXT(2) | | |TRIG_COUNT| | |
151 | | | TRIG_INT | | | | | |
152 | +---------+--------------+-----------+------------+----------+ | |
153 | ||
154 | Note 1: If AI command and AO command are used simultaneously, only | |
155 | one may have scan_begin_src == TRIG_TIMER. | |
156 | ||
157 | Note 2: scan_begin_src == TRIG_EXT is only supported if the card is | |
158 | configured as a PCI230+ and is only supported on later | |
159 | versions of the card. As a card configured as a PCI230+ is | |
160 | not guaranteed to support external triggering, please consider | |
161 | this support to be a bonus. It uses the EXTTRIG/ EXTCONVCLK | |
162 | input (PCI230+ pin 25). Triggering will be on the rising edge | |
163 | unless the CR_INVERT flag is set in scan_begin_arg. | |
164 | ||
165 | The channels in the channel sequence must be in ascending order with | |
166 | no repeats. All entries in the channel sequence must use the same | |
167 | output range. | |
168 | ||
169 | DIO Subdevice: | |
170 | ||
171 | The DIO subdevice is a 8255 chip providing 24 DIO channels. The DIO | |
172 | channels are configurable as inputs or outputs in four groups: | |
173 | ||
174 | Port A - channels 0 to 7 | |
175 | Port B - channels 8 to 15 | |
176 | Port CL - channels 16 to 19 | |
177 | Port CH - channels 20 to 23 | |
178 | ||
179 | Only mode 0 of the 8255 chip is supported. | |
180 | ||
181 | Bit 0 of port C (DIO channel 16) is also used as an external scan | |
182 | trigger input for AI commands on PCI230 and PCI230+, so would need to | |
183 | be configured as an input to use it for that purpose. | |
